         <title>Just 1 in 5 medical malpractice cases end in settlements or judgments for patients, study says</title>
         <description><![CDATA[<p>Only 1 in 5 malpractice claims against doctors leads to a settlement or other payout, according to a new study published in the New England Journal Medicine. Most patients who are harmed are not able to pursue a lawsuit.</p>]]></description>

         <title>Medicare rule would decrease payments to hospitals with high re-admission rates</title>
         <description><![CDATA[<p>In an effort to save money and improve care, Medicare, the federal program for the elderly and disabled, is about to release a final rule aimed at getting hospitals to pay more attention to patients after discharge. This includes cutting back payments to hospitals where high numbers of patients are re-admitted [often due to infections or medical harm].</p>]]></description>

         <title>Many hospitals overuse double CT scans, data show</title>
         <description><![CDATA[<p>Hundreds of hospitals are routinely performing a type of chest scan that experts say should be used rarely, subjecting patients to double doses of radiation and driving up health-care costs.</p>]]></description>
